7.27 Battery Compensation (Address 2Fh)
7.27.1 Battery Compensation
Configures automatic adjustment of the speaker volume when VP deviates from VPREF[3:0].
7.27.2 VP Monitor
Configures the internal ADC that monitors the VP voltage level.
Notes:
1. The internal ADC that monitors the VP supply is enabled automatically when BATTCMP is enabled, re-
gardless of the VPMONITOR setting. Conversely, when BATTCMP is disabled, the ADC may be en-
abled by enabling VPMONITOR; this provides a convenient battery monitor without enabling battery
compensation.
2. When enabled, VPMONITOR remains enabled regardless of the PDN bit setting.
